As far as meetings go, the week will quiet down as we approach my favorite holiday, Christmas Eve, on Thursday, followed by Christmas Day on Friday.

Speaking of Friday, those with trash and recycling collection on Fridays may place their material at the curb between 4 p.m. and midnight Friday evening. However, they should anticipate some collection delays, common after holidays and during the winter season. The same goes for next Friday, which is New Year's Day. However, if that’s not possible, and you have to place your materials cyrbsuide prior to Friday, you won’t be penalized.
